Course structure

• Montessori Philosophy and Principles
• The History of Montessori Education
• Child Development Theories
• Social Studies Curriculum in Montessori Education
• Cultural Studies and Geography
• Peace Education and Conflict Resolution
• Community Engagement and Service Learning
• Diversity and Inclusion in the Montessori Classroom
• Observational Research Methods
• Ethics and Professionalism in Montessori Education
